Spinal cord injuries

Spinal cord injuries are one of the most serious types of injuries that aren't always apparent immediately. They can be debilitating, painful and even life-threatening. With the assistance of an experienced lawyer, you may be able get the compensation you deserve.

If you've suffered a spinal injury, you may be entitled to compensation for the pain and suffering, the loss of income, and medical bills. These losses can be large. They can be a lot and you may need to be absent from work for a while.

You may also be compensated for non-economic losses. Although it's difficult to quantify the pain and suffering, a skilled attorney can help you obtain an estimate.

Spinal cord injuries can result from medical errors, accidents, Back Injury Claim or even defective products. To recover damages you can sue if you've suffered injuries due to negligence of someone else's.

The value of your settlement will vary, according to the severity of your injury. A less severe spinal cord injury can result in a smaller settlement than one that has a more serious injury.

The claim you file could also be based on your state's personal injury laws. For instance in New York, you have only two years from the date of the injury to file a lawsuit.

Even if the injury isn't immediately apparent, it's vital to seek out a physician as soon as possible. This will ensure that you receive a proper diagnosis. You might also be afflicted with other injuries or complications If you don't seek treatment.

It is crucial to remember that the amount of your settlement will depend on your age, injury and how your recovery will impact your quality of life. Additionally, your potential settlement must take into account your permanent disability and loss of consolation with your spouse.

Whiplash

Whiplash lawsuits against back injuries is a challenging procedure. Insurance companies often attempt to intimidate you or even challenge your medical knowledge. Insurance companies also look at your medical history and your previous experiences when determining how much you will be paid.

You should seek out an experienced personal injury attorney. This will ensure that you receive the most effective compensation. You may receive a different amount depending on the severity of your injuries as well as the time it takes to resolve your case.

You are likely to receive two types of compensation that are general and specific. General damages encompass the usual types of damages, such as pain and suffering. They are typically based on the victim's emotional and physical trauma.

Special damages are given when the party who suffered the injury can prove that the loss was monetary. This can be accomplished by presenting receipts or bills that provide proof of the cost and that you sustained a particular type of injury.

It can take months or even a full year to obtain an acceptable settlement for whiplash injuries. After the initial offer is made, the insurance company will often set a deadline for it. This could result in an amount that is lower than if the trial has been completed.

There aren't any hard and fast rules. However, the average whiplash settlement is between one thousand and more than $20,000. It is recommended to talk to an attorney about your options.
